"If it's WRITTEN,like software, then it should be protected by COPYRIGHT"
I totaly agree.
Only ideas should be patented. Software is mearly a list of instructions much as the plan we get with MFI furnature to aid construction.
Should these plans now be patented? I have an instruction manual for the motherboard on this computer, these words used to construct it are copyrighted. Would the writer be able to patent this book? No, of course not, because he has not produced an original idea!
If software is classed as patentable then I suggest the authors of written words, who are still alive should demant thgat their books be patented. That should keep the patent offices buisy.
